Kathryn Snyder
PCC, CPCC · CEO & Founder
Two decades in corporate America — engineering, operations, people leadership at E*Trade and Capital One. Two burnouts. One honest question: what's dying while I'm busy succeeding? That question built Attune. She believes aliveness is the map.

M.Ed. · Partner & COO
From the plains of South Dakota to eleven years leading schools in Santiago, Chile — Nicki has spent twenty years watching people become more themselves. Her methodology is relational and somatic. She believes belonging is the precondition for everything else.
